Output dbcf106b8a661b521021d7ceae94a914b600a8604240961e0cf9ebefdb68157e:1

value
2668720
script pubkey
OP_0 OP_PUSHBYTES_20 b296a5c4111db1700fb8b2fe0d09cfbc3392d3bf
address
ltc1qk2t2t3q3rkchqracktlq6zw0hsee95alugjsr7
transaction
dbcf106b8a661b521021d7ceae94a914b600a8604240961e0cf9ebefdb68157e
spent
true